- Bits are manufactured to the highest tolerances and specifications for straightness, concentricity and precise tip fit to the fastener
- Heat treat to prevent shattering and premature bit wear
- Bits are retained in the bit holder by a set screw that locks securely into a groove on the bit for positive bit retention as well as simple, easy bit replacement
- Broached hex in the bit holder allows higher torque loads
- Eye-D™ markings optimize size visibility
- No eye-d markings on a suffix bit sockets
- Bits are press fit on a suffix bit sockets
- 94-109 Replacement bit
